Veterinarian and Animal Hospital Near Brookline, NH: Delivering the Highest Standard of Pet Care

All Pets Veterinary Hospital, conveniently located near Brookline, NH, is an AAHA-accredited animal hospital offering up the very best in veterinary care, customer service, and individualized treatment. As a pet parent, you have a lot on your plate, and caring for your pet can be a challenge at the best of times. Our motivated team of animal lovers is here to give you the support you need to make the most informed and appropriate choices on behalf of your pet so they can enjoy the longest and healthiest life possible. We also use low-stress handling techniques to make our patients feel at ease in our hospital and be more receptive to the treatments they need. If you’re looking for a veterinarian who wants the best for you and your pet, you’ve come to the right place!

Veterinary Services We Offer for Brookline, NH Dogs and Cats

Supporting your pet’s health and wellness for the long term requires different services and a personalized approach to understanding and meeting their needs. The veterinarians and staff of All Pets Veterinary Hospital know that every dog and cat is unique and deserves a treatment plan that works best for them, not a one-size-fits-all program.

Services provided at our animal hospital include:

Experience Stress-Free Care for Your Pet in Brookline, NH

The long-term effects of stress can be harmful to your pet, not just from a mental standpoint but a physical one as well. Stress takes its toll on the body and can lower the immune system. What’s more, it can keep dogs and cats from seeing their vet as regularly as they should. All Pets Veterinary Hospital implements stress-free care to alleviate stress in pets as much as possible so they can be happier and healthier overall.

Here are some of the ways we work to reduce our patients’ stress:

  • Our veterinarians and staff handle pets gently and minimally
  • We only see one pet at a time in our designated treatment area
  • We are careful not to make any quick or sudden movements, which can startle pets
  • iiOur team members are careful to speak in low, soothing voices

If you would like to know more about what we do to lower stress levels and make vet care more pleasant for our dog and cat patients, feel free to call us at (603) 882-0494! We look forward to speaking with you.